大数据可视化系统自己怎么做
-
大数据可视化系统是将海量的数据通过可视化方式展现出来,帮助用户更直观地理解数据之间的关系和规律。要自己搭建一个大数据可视化系统,需要经历以下几个步骤:
-
数据收集和清洗:首先需要确定需要展示的数据类型,然后搜集这些数据并进行清洗,确保数据的准确性和完整性。
-
数据存储:根据数据的量级和类型选择适当的数据库或数据仓库来存储数据,在大数据可视化系统中常用的数据存储包括关系型数据库(如MySQL)、非关系型数据库(如MongoDB)、数据湖等。
-
数据处理和计算:对存储的数据进行处理和计算,以便为可视化展示提供支持。这一步可以包括数据清洗、数据转换、数据聚合、计算指标等操作。
-
可视化设计:选择合适的可视化工具和库(如D3.js、Echarts、Tableau等)来设计和呈现数据可视化图表。根据数据类型和展示需求,设计各类图表,如折线图、柱状图、饼图、热力图等。
-
前端展示:将设计好的可视化图表嵌入到前端界面中,以方便用户交互。前端展示可以使用Web开发技术(如HTML、CSS、JavaScript)来搭建用户友好的交互式界面。
-
用户交互和控制:为用户提供灵活的交互功能,如筛选、排序、搜索等,以便用户根据需要自定义查看数据和图表。
-
数据更新和实时展示:保持数据的及时性和准确性,可以设置定时任务或实时数据流来更新数据,并将更新后的数据及时展示给用户。
通过以上步骤,可以搭建一个功能完善的大数据可视化系统,帮助用户更好地理解和利用海量的数据。
1年前 -
-
构建一个大数据可视化系统需要考虑许多因素,包括数据的收集、处理、存储、以及展示等方面。以下是自己搭建一个大数据可视化系统的具体步骤和流程:
-
确定需求:首先,需要明确你想要展示的数据类型、目标受众以及需要实现的功能。例如,你可能需要展示销售数据、用户行为数据或者社交媒体数据等。
-
数据收集:确定好需求后,就需要开始收集数据。可以通过API、日志文件、数据库等方式来获取数据。确保数据的准确性和完整性。
-
数据处理:收集到数据后,需要进行清洗、处理和转换,以便后续的分析和可视化。这个环节通常包括数据清洗、去重、格式转换等步骤。
-
数据存储:处理完的数据需要进行存储。可以选择使用关系型数据库(如MySQL、PostgreSQL)、非关系型数据库(如MongoDB、Elasticsearch)、内存数据库(如Redis)等。选择合适的存储方式可以提高系统性能。
-
数据分析:在数据存储的基础上,可以进行数据分析,以发现数据间的关联性、规律性和趋势。常用的数据分析工具有Python的Pandas、R语言等。
-
可视化设计:根据需求和数据分析结果,设计合适的可视化图表和界面。选择合适的图表类型(如折线图、柱状图、饼图等),并考虑布局、色彩搭配等因素。
-
可视化工具:选择合适的可视化工具来实现设计的可视化效果。常用的大数据可视化工具包括Tableau、Power BI、Plotly、D3.js等。根据需求和技术水平选择合适的工具。
-
构建前端界面:将设计好的可视化图表集成到前端界面中,使用户可以直观地查看数据。可以使用HTML、CSS、JavaScript等前端技术来构建界面。
-
后端开发:搭建后端服务,用于数据的处理、存储和展示。可以选择使用Python(Flask、Django)、Java(Spring Boot)、Node.js等后端技术。
-
部署运维:完成系统开发后,需要将系统部署到服务器上,并进行运维管理。确保系统的稳定性和安全性。
通过以上步骤,就可以完成搭建一个大数据可视化系统。在实际开发中,需要不断优化和调整系统,以适应不断变化的需求和数据。
1年前 -
-
搭建大数据可视化系统的方法和操作流程
1. 确定需求和目标
在搭建大数据可视化系统之前,首先需要明确系统的目标和需求。确定需要展示的数据种类、展示的方式、用户群体等信息,有针对性地制定搭建方案。
2. 选择合适的工具和技术
在选择搭建大数据可视化系统时,需要考虑一些常用的工具和技术,比如:
- 数据存储和处理技术:如Hadoop、Spark等。
- 可视化工具:如Tableau、Power BI、Superset等。
- 前端开发技术:如JavaScript、React、D3.js等。
根据需求和预算选择合适的工具和技术,保证系统具有较高的性能和用户体验。
3. 准备数据源
大数据可视化系统的核心是展示数据,因此准备好数据源是至关重要的一步。确保数据源的质量和完整性,经过清洗和处理后再进行可视化展示。
4. 搭建数据处理流程
在搭建大数据可视化系统时,需要设计和搭建数据处理流程,包括数据的采集、清洗、存储和分析等环节。确保数据的准确性和实时性,为后续的可视化展示提供支持。
5. 设计和开发前端界面
根据需求和目标设计系统的前端界面,选择合适的可视化工具或自行开发可视化组件。确保界面简洁直观,用户友好,同时具有较高的交互性和可定制性。
6. 进行系统集成和测试
在搭建大数据可视化系统的过程中,需要进行系统集成和测试,确保各个模块和组件能够正常工作。通过测试发现和修复潜在的问题,提高系统的稳定性和可靠性。
7. 部署和运维
完成系统搭建后,需要进行系统部署和运维工作。确保系统能够稳定运行并及时处理异常,同时根据用户反馈和需求进行系统优化和升级。
8. 用户培训和支持
在系统上线后,开展用户培训和支持工作,帮助用户熟悉系统的功能和操作流程,提高用户的使用体验和满意度。
通过以上步骤和流程,搭建一个完善的大数据可视化系统,为用户提供优质的数据展示和分析服务。
1年前